Trevor Merrill
(Consultant) Trevor Merrill received his B.A. in Literature from Yale in 2000 and is now a doctoral student in the French and Francophone Studies Department at UCLA. He presented at the 2006 COV&R conference and will present at COV&R 2007. His current research focuses on "totalitarian marivaudage," myth, and theology in the novels of Milan Kundera. He has a special interest in apocalypse and conversion. He lives in Paris where he is a resident student at the Ecole Normale Superieure in Paris.
